Tree Trimming Scheduled at Keaʻau Transfer Station

The County of Hawaiʻi Department of Environmental Management has scheduled tree trimming along the driveway entrance to the Keaʻau Transfer Station between 8 a.m. and 4:45 p.m. daily from Jan. 14-16.

The work will require intermittent lane closures at the driveway entrance, and access to the public water spigots will be limited during this time.

To ensure public safety, the following measures will be in place:

  • A traffic control contractor and two officers will be onsite throughout the duration of the project.
  • Incoming vehicles will be given priority to minimize backups onto Highway 130. Motorists exiting the facility are advised to expect delays.
  • An electronic sign board will be near the station to notify the public of the upcoming work and to anticipate delays.

For further information, contact the Department of Environmental Management’s Solid Waste Division at (808) 961-8270.
